WebIn a large bowl, combine the pumpkin puree, brown sugar and granulated sugar. Add the flour, salt, cinnamon, ginger, nutmeg and cloves and stir until smooth. Add the egg and egg yolk and stir until combined. Add the cream, vanilla and brandy and stir until smooth. Pour the filling into the tart shell.
